+Become a Developer
+------------------
+dpkt uses the 'GitHub Flow' model: `GitHub Flow <http://scottchacon.com/2011/08/31/github-flow.html>`_
+
+- To work on something new, create a descriptively named branch off of master (ie: my-awesome)
+- Commit to that branch locally and regularly push your work to the same named branch on the server
+- When you need feedback or help, or you think the branch is ready for merging, open a pull request
+- After someone else has reviewed and signed off on the feature, you can merge it into master

+New Feature or Bug
+~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+
+ ::
+
+ $ git checkout -b my-awesome
+ $ git push -u origin my-awesome
+ $ <code for a bit>; git push
+ $ <code for a bit>; git push
+ $ tox (this will run all the tests)
+
+ - Go to github and hit 'New pull request'
+ - Someone reviews it and says 'AOK'
+ - Merge the pull request (green button)
